Fixed term contract to 30 September 2020 (Maternity cover)
37 hours per week, Full Year

We are seeking to appoint an Administration Assistant who will provide effective and proactive maternity cover for this key role within our Central team. In this role, you will be the first point of contact for the trust and support Central Team colleagues in business support functions including Governance, Finance and HR, as well as our Welfare team and Chief Executive Officer. This will give you the opportunity to be involved in innovative work within the trust and to facilitate essential business; designing communications materials, collating papers for our governors, analysing surveys and note-taking.

We are looking for someone who has experience in a similar role covering a range of administrative duties, with excellent organisational skills and a flexible and cooperative attitude. With effective verbal and written communication skills to suit a variety of audiences, you will be able present information in a variety of written styles and formats with attention to detail, utilising excellent IT skills including with MS Office applications. The ideal candidate will build relationships quickly and as appropriate, work in a systematic and orderly manner and have the ability to work to a brief to achieve set objectives.

In return we can offer
• The chance to work within a small, highly motivated team
• The opportunity to gain experience in supporting a range of services including general administration, finance, human resources and governance support
• The benefits of being part of a growing, collaborative organisation with a commitment to lifelong learning.

The normal working hours of this post are expected to be 8.30-4.30, Monday-Thursday and 8.30-4.00, Friday during term-time, although there will be more flexibility during school holidays. Occasional evening work may be required to support trust events and some travel between our sites within east Newcastle will be involved.
